I am using qmail + spamassassin + courierimap + squirrelmail and it works beautifully. There was a lot of reading and playing before I could make qmail hum. The biggest hurdle with qmail is it uses Dan Bernstein's way of monitoring processes and moves away from the inetd superserver, and it can take a little getting used to. Courier was a pain to compile on solaris 8 but was a dream on a debian system. Squirrelmail is a great webmail tool if you need one, I have also had great success with imp both require a web server though ( it is webmail after all :). Mailman is a good mailing list manager with a web frontend if you need to manage lists.

If I had it all to do over I would probably go with Postfix though. It has a rich feature set and allows great control over mail delivery. Spam Assassin is great and Iw would say it is a necessity in todays email world.
